Vital Measurements for Process Improvement Operation Output
To effectively assess quality control success, it’s important to concentrate on important indicators . These often feature error rate, which measures the degree of mistakes ; Cycle Time , showcasing the duration required to complete a task ; Initial Yield , signifying the proportion of products produced accurately the immediately; and Process Capability Index (Cp & Cpk) , which evaluates the capacity of a system to meet client needs. Constantly examining these figures delivers significant insights into process health and identifies areas for improvement .

Sigma Levels and Their Impact on Process Performance
Knowing sigma levels is essential for enhancing process performance . A higher capability index generally suggests fewer defects and greater consistency in a production system . For example , a process capability of 6 represents only 3.4 defects per million opportunities , contributing to substantial gains in overall efficiency. Conversely, lower quality scores often highlight opportunities for refinement and a greater chance of production issues.
